Bruce is a city in Mississippi, located in Calhoun County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 3,186 residents. It is a middle-aged city, with a median age of 42.7 years.
Economically, Bruce is a working-class community. The median household income of $42,500 is below the national average. Approximately 17.4%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 4.0%, below the national average.
The real estate market in Bruce is one of the more affordable housing markets in the country. Median home values stand at $86,600, which is well below the national average. Renters typically pay around $648 per month. Homeownership is high at 67.7%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.
The population of Bruce is moderately educated. 33.5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— near the national average. The community is majority White (67.8%).
